1️⃣ Derivatives Market Short Liquidation Driving Price Upward
The recent surge in PIPPIN has been significantly driven by liquidity dynamics in the derivatives market. There exists large-scale short positions in the market. The short trader “Mysterious K-line” has held positions for 45 days since opening on November 22, 2024, with current unrealized losses reaching 2.843 million USD. Adding high-frequency funding costs, cumulative losses reach 4.945 million USD. Such substantial losses typically accompany forced short liquidations, creating cascading short squeeze effects that push up prices. Additionally, since November 30th, PIPPIN has mostly experienced negative funding rates, indicating significant short position pressure, with continuous short liquidation demand supporting price rebounds. While this derivatives-driven rally can quickly amplify short-term gains, its sustainability requires further observation.
2️⃣ Non-linear Volatility Characteristics in High-Leverage Environment
The high-leverage structure of the derivatives market causes PIPPIN to exhibit significant volatility characteristics. With large open interest sizes, prices can easily trigger cascading liquidations with minor movements, causing non-linear rapid reversals. Over the past week, PIPPIN has fluctuated sharply between 0.28 USD and 0.61 USD, with single-hour declines exceeding 20%, reflecting extreme volatility risks in a high-leverage environment. This market microstructure feature suggests subsequent price action may exhibit rapid reversals, with price movements primarily driven by liquidity structure rather than fundamentals.
3️⃣ Concentrated Chip Distribution Amplifying Price Manipulation Risk
On-chain data shows PIPPIN’s chip distribution is highly concentrated, with 93 wallets controlling 80% of token supply. Additionally, there are 16 new wallets with identical accumulation patterns and 11 associated wallets collectively holding approximately 9% of total supply. Such extremely concentrated holdings structure gives a small number of funds enormous price influence, amplifying volatility risk. The scarcity of substantive fundamental narrative updates and project team information disclosures further reinforces that price movements are dominated by liquidity and fund structure characteristics.
